WinCC flexible Anmeldedialog

netmaster

Level-1
Beiträge
534
Reaktionspunkte
67
Zuviel Werbung?
-> Hier kostenlos registrieren
Hallo zusammen,

wenn ich auf eine Schaltfläche eine Berechtigung lege, der Bediner diese Schaltfläche drückt erscheint der Anmeldedialog.
Jetzt kann der Kunde Benutzername und Passwort eingeben und drückt auf OK.
Aber um die Funktion der Schaltfläche auszuführen muss er noch mal diese drücken.
Unser Kunde will das er nur einmal drückt, das Anmeldefenster kommt und wenn er mit OK bestätigt die aktion ausgeführt wird.

Jemand eine Idee wie man dies machen könnte?

Danke
 
wenn ich auf eine Schaltfläche eine Berechtigung lege, der Bediner diese Schaltfläche drückt erscheint der Anmeldedialog.
Jetzt kann der Kunde Benutzername und Passwort eingeben und drückt auf OK.
Aber um die Funktion der Schaltfläche auszuführen muss er noch mal diese drücken.
Unser Kunde will das er nur einmal drückt, das Anmeldefenster kommt und wenn er mit OK bestätigt die aktion ausgeführt wird.
Hallo Netmaster,
da fällt mir nur eine Möglichkeit ein:
Du gibst die Berechtigung für die Taste frei und machst Dir für diese Taste einen eigenen Anmeldedialog.
Dieser neue Anmeldedialog hat ein Eingabefeld für das Passwort und eine OK / Abbruchtaste Taste.
Nun das Passwort und die OK Taste in der SPS auswerten.
Hat aber dann nichts mehr mit der Benutzerverwaltung von Flex zu tun.

Eine andere Möglichkeit: Sich die Betätigung der Schaltfläche in der SPS zu merken (Berechtigung wieder freigeben) und erst die Funktion einschalten wenn das Passwort eingegeben wurde.
Großer Nachteil und daher fast nicht vertretbar:
Wenn das Passwort nun nicht eingegeben wird, oder erst viel später, ist das Bit der Schaltfläche ja immer noch aktiv.

Eigentlich kenne ich das Problem nur bei Eingabewerten:
Erst neuen Wert eingeben, dann kommt die Meldung "Anmelden", dann muss der Wert erneut eingegeben werden.
Das nervt wirklich.
Das löse ich meist mit einer unsichtbaren Schaltfläche die darüber liegt.
Aber in Deinem Fall bringt eine unsichtbare Schaltfläche auch nichts, da auch zweimal gedrückt werden muss.
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Danke für deine Antwort.
Sowas in der Art ist mir heute dann auch noch eingefallen.
Wenn er auf den Taster drückt öffne ich jetzt einen Screenshort vom Anmeldedialog. Wo zwei E/A Felder drüber liegen. Hier kann er Benutzername und Passwort eingeben. Beim Drücken auf Ok führe ich ein Script aus mit Logon und den zwei Variablen aus, usw.
Könnte man sich dann ziemlich spielen damit.
Muss sich der Kunde damit zufrieden geben das es einfach nicht geht ;)
 
Hallo,

ich weiß es nicht genau, aber gibt es vielleicht eine Systemmeldung für eine erfolgreiche Anmeldung?
Wenn diese Meldung erscheint, kannst du vielleicht auf die Meldung reagieren und das entsprechende Bild über Ereignisse aufrufen...
 
Solche Ideen hatte ich auch schon. Das Problem ist halt nur das ich viele verschiedene Taster habe, die wo mit Berechtigungen belegt sind. Da müsste ich jetzt zusätzlich jedesmal auswerten welcher Taster gedrückt wird und was passieren soll.
Diese Funktion ist leider einfach nicht möglich mit Flexible.
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Solche Ideen hatte ich auch schon. Das Problem ist halt nur das ich viele verschiedene Taster habe, die wo mit Berechtigungen belegt sind. Da müsste ich jetzt zusätzlich jedesmal auswerten welcher Taster gedrückt wird und was passieren soll.
Diese Funktion ist leider einfach nicht möglich mit Flexible.

Wo läuft das flexible denn?
Dann geht es eventuell über Scripte? Oder über eine angeschlossene Steuerung?
 
hat denn jemand mittlerweile eine Lösung für das Problem?
Denn 2 mal klicken finde ich auch nicht gerade professionell,....
 
Zurück
Oben